Historic building
The is a one-room log building, built in 1904 as an artist's studio for Chris Jorgensen in the . Jorgensen, an instructor and assistant director of the California School of Fine Arts, arrived in Yosemite in the 1890s. is situated 1½ miles southeast of Wawona Campground Amphitheater.

The was built by Jeremiah Hodgdon in 1879 in the Aspen Valley area of what became . The two-story log cabin, measuring 22 feet by 30 feet, was located in an inholding in the park, owned by Hodgdon's descendants. is situated 1½ miles southeast of Wawona Campground Amphitheater.
